Evolution of Spatial Audio in Home Entertainment

But how exactly did we get here? The evolution of spatial audio has been a journey marked by innovation and technological advancements. It all started with stereo sound, revolutionising how we listened to music by separating audio channels to create a sense of depth and directionality.

Then came surround sound, which took things a step further by adding additional audio channels to envelop the listener in sound from all directions. Suddenly, movie nights at home felt like a trip to the cinema, with sound effects coming at you from every angle.

But the true game-changer has been the rise of immersive audio technologies like Dolby Atmos and DTS: X. These systems go beyond traditional surround sound by incorporating height channels, allowing sound to move around you and above you. The result is an immersive experience that puts you in the middle of the action.
